Me Za Li
Me Za Li is a village in Kyain Seikgyi Township, Kawkareik District, Kayin State. Me Za Li is situated nearby to the village Meit Ta Bwee, as well as near Lon Si.Places in the Area

Apalon
Village
Apalon is a village alongside the Zami River in Kyain Seikgyi Township, Kawkareik District, Karen State, south-eastern Myanmar. The areas around Apalon are mountainous and forested. Apalon is situated 6 miles southeast of Me Za Li.
